Where was the photo taken that year when the flowers were blooming and the moon was full?
Filming location
Five provinces and one city in China
"That Year the Flowers Bloomed and the Moon Was Full" is a period drama produced by China Television Entertainment Investment Group Co., Ltd. Directed by Ding Hei, starring Sun Li and Chen Xiao
The play is based on the historical facts of the Wu family in Anwu Fort, Jingyang County, Shaanxi Province, and tells the ups and downs of Zhou Ying, the richest woman in Shaanxi who was born among the people in the late Qing Dynasty. life story
